LeedsCityRam Posted April 24, 2021 Share Posted April 24, 2021 It's the thought process that I'm struggling with. Biggest game for ages, a big opportunity to get a positive result & we go back to a timid, defensive line up. Knight & Shinnie in midfield offering very little quality, a diet of long balls onto the heads of very capable opposition CBs & a total inability to string more than 3 passes together. The lead flattered us at half time, it was a total 50/50 game with very little quality shown & nothing of note happening that first 25 mins. Brum then switched off on their right side & credit to Buchanan for the measured cross & Kazim for his positioning to finish. Second half, Bowyer tweaks their formation & they started getting on top. If your entire MO is copying the opposition, why wouldn't you do it when they switch & start taking charge of the game? The marking for both of their goals was just criminal & is becoming an increasing habit. Its just too easy. Throwing Jozwiak & Roberts on after 86 mins was just insulting & totally pointless given we just launched the ball into their box that last 10 mins...and by then Kazim had gone off. Totally clueless & yet another failure to beat a bottom half side. I have no faith in this team or management to earn another point. Over to you South Yorkshire.
